#738ad4 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#738ad4 is composed of 45.1% red, 54.1%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.8% cyan, 34.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 225.8 degrees, a saturation of 53% and a lightness of 64.1%. #738ad4 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ffff with #0015a9.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#738ad4 color description : Slightly desaturated blue.

The hexadecimal color #738ad4 has RGB values of R:115, G:138,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 7572180.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03050a is the darkest color, while #fafbfd is the lightest one.
